John Scott
John Scott
Defenseman
Number: 36
Height: 6' 8"
Weight: 270
Shoots: Left
Born: Sep 26, 1982  (Age 30)
Birthplace: Edmonton, AB, Canada

Acquired: Signed as a free agent, December 31, 2006.
2012-13:
• Led all Sabres skaters with seven fighting majors
• Logged a season-high 11:00 TOI vs. NYR (4/19) and registered three hits
• Logged 10:24 TOI at BOS (4/17) and tallied three shots on goal
• Logged 10:43 TOI vs. TBL (4/14) and was credited with three shots
• Registered a team-high five hits vs. PHI (4/13)
• Logged 9:11 TOI vs. NJD (4/7) and 9:16 at WPG (4/9)
• Made his Sabres debut vs. PHI (1/20)

2008-09
* Picked up first NHL point (assist) at STL (3/15)
* Recalled 3/8 for second time of season
* Recalled 1/3 and made NHL debut vs. Detroit that night logging 5:54 in ice-time and blocked 3 shots
* Recorded four points (2-2=4) and 111 PIM in 44 games with Houston this season.
